July 30th, 2015

NHTSA Campaign Number: 15V482000
Manufacturer: HEARTLAND RECREATIONAL VEHICLES, LLC
Manufacturer Campaign Number: 99-01-23
Manufactured Begin Date: January 1st, 2010
Manufactured End Date: July 23rd, 2015
Date of Owner Notification: September 29th, 2015

Defect Summary:
Heartland Recreational Vehicles, LLC (Heartland) is recalling certain trailers of various models and model years. Click on "All Products Associated With This Recall" for a complete list. The tire certification labels applied to the vehicles may contain inaccurate tire sizing and/or inflation information.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of 49 CFR Part 567, "Certification."

Consequence Summary:
An owner or operator could rely on the inaccurate information in inflating the tires which could cause under or over inflation which, in turn, could lead to a tire failure or crash.

Corrective Summary:
Heartland will notify owners, and dealers will send a replacement label with the correct information, free of charge. The recall began on September 29, 2015. Owners may contact Heartland customer service at 1-574-266-3988.

October 8th, 2010

NHTSA Campaign Number: 10V461000
Manufacturer: HEARTLAND RECREATIONAL VEHICLES, LLC
Manufacturer Campaign Number: 99-01-03
Manufactured Begin Date: August 9th, 2010
Manufactured End Date: September 3rd, 2010
Date of Owner Notification: October 20th, 2010

Defect Summary:
HEARTLAND I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2011 FIFTH WHEEL TRAILERS EQUIPPED WITH DEXTER AXLES. ON SOME AXLES, CRACKS COULD APPEAR IN THE SPINDLE WELD.

Consequence Summary:
THESE CRACKS CAN PROPAGATE AND CAUSE THE SPINDLE TO DETACH FROM THE AXLE TUBE, RESULTING IN THE SEPARATION OF THE WHEEL END FROM THE VEHICLE, CREATING A ROAD HAZARD THAT INCREASES THE RISK OF A CRASH TO OTHER VEHICLES, AND COMPROMISES THE DRIVER'S CONTROL OF THE VEHICLE INCREASING THE RISK OF A VEHICLE CRASH.

Corrective Summary:
HEARTLAND IS WORKING WITH DEXTER AXLE AND WILL INSPECT THE AXLE SERIAL NUMBER AND REPLACE IT IF IT FALLS WITHIN THE SERIAL NUMBER RANGE. REPLACEMENT OF THE AXLE WILL BE PERFORMED F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ON OCTOBER 20, 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T HEARTLAND WARRANTY SERVICE DEPARTMENT AT 1-877-262-8032 OR DEXTER AXLE AT 1-800-400-2164.
